we explore how fear repeatedly led the apostle Peter to fail, from rebuking Jesus, to denying him, to remaining silent when the truth needed defending. Yet Peter's story doesn't end in failure. Through God's grace, he learned to trust instead of fear, eventually becoming a courageous leader who stood firm even at the cost of his own life.
